寒燈無焰 敝裘無溫 總是播弄光景 身如槁木 心似死灰 不免墮在頑空 (後 14)
Saying that there is no fire in a cold lamp and no warmth in a worn-out leather garment are all arbitrary understanding of boundaries. If you say that your body ans mind is like a dead tree and dead ashes, you have misunderstood the concept of Śūnyatā. (Book2 14)
The negation of the negation becomes the positivity. If everything is empty, the empty is empty, so it is not empty. For example, let's apply the premise that everything changes with respect to death. Death of death is birth. Empty means that there is no fixed entity.
